"We stayed in the Gallery room, it was absolutely massive, even by North American standards. It had great AC that was silent, and a number of sitting options that were comfortable. There was a Nespresso machine with pods and full kitchenette, but there wasn't any plates, pots, pans, cutlery, etc.
Shower was really great, however note that bathroom sinks are not directly outside the toilet room (the kitchen sink was, but it had no soap).
The TV doesn't rotate, despite being on a pole, so you can only watch it from couches, not from bed, missed opportunity.
Breakfast was premium/very high quality, but the staff told us it wasn't included, despite out email/booking saying it was.
The staff didn't seem the most helpful, even though they were friendly. The breakfast not included thing left a bit of a sour taste, and a lot of the times we went down to ask something no one was there. We did however get a credit for the snackbar with our booking, which was really cool and nice as we were able to get some beers and snacks.
This hotel is outside of the city in the middle of a business park. There was likely bus service for free, but we were there on a Sunday and never saw it.
We didn't use any spa services, so we can't comment, but it was a very nice place regardless and felt upscale."

What's the best time of year to book my B&B in Perl?
When you're planning your escape to Perl, be sure to take into account the year-round temperatures. The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 64°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 38°F. Average annual precipitation for Perl is 34 inches.
What is there to do in Perl?
When you want to explore some things to do in town, Roemische Villa Borg and Saar-Hunsrueck Nature Park are some notable sights to visit. You might check out Bioweingut Ollinger-Gelz if you have time to see more of the area.
How can I get to and around Perl?
You can map out your trip in and around Perl 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Findel International Airport (LUX), which is located 13.5 mi (21.7 km) away from the city center. If you'd like to explore around the area, consider renting a car to take in more sights.
